Understanding the Context
Economic pressures, shifting values, and digital transformation have created a perfect storm. Remote and hybrid models have normalized flexibility; gig and project-based work are no longer niche but mainstream. Employers now compete fiercely for talent, while workers increasingly value meaning, autonomy, and mental well-being over steady but rigid career structures. These dynamics reflect a deeper cultural pivot: people are redefining success beyond steady paychecks and promotions. The Express Employment Shock captures this pulse—more workers quitting fast than ever before, driven not by crisis, but by deeper mismatches between past employment expectations and current realities.

Common Questions About Express Employment Shock: Why Millions Are Quitting Fast and What’ll Happen Next
How does this affect job stability for employers?
Turnover rates have risen, but mitigmating mass exits as chaos overlooks strategic adaptation. Forward-looking companies are embracing fluid talent models—integrating contract experts, part-time innovators, and AI-augmented workforces—to stay agile. Stability now means responsiveness, not rigidity.
Will unemployment rise as workers quit fast?
Not across the board. Rather than shrinking labor supply, shifting patterns reflect reallocation: workers moving between roles, industries, or sectors. This transition challenges traditional metrics but signals evolution, not decline.
How can employers retain talent in a shift-driven market?
Focus on purpose, growth, and flexibility. Organizations that cultivate clarity around mission, support continuous learning, and reward adaptability see stronger loyalty. Building vibrant cultures and offering autonomy are keys—no script, just intentional design.
What industries feel the most impact?
Tech, professional services, healthcare, and education are leading the shift, with digital-first platforms enabling faster talent matching and remote engagement, redefining traditional employment boundaries.
